Hi guys,

Like Frank (and others), I have been writing in-box and some build reviews for some time and from the feedback these are generally appreciated by many so they can see what is in the box when the kit first comes out without having to wait for build reviews that generally take a month or so to appear.

I feel in-box and build reviews compliment each other, one lets people know what they are getting and the other highlights any traps or problems during construction something obviously an in-box review can show in full, but they can identify any glaring deficiencies if the kit is given a thorough going over.

As those who do these reviews will know they take time to research the kit, do the images (after all the net is basically a visual medium) and write a detailed review. A review of an average sized full kit usually takes a minimum of five hours (usually more) and would hate to think that is a waste of time?

As to building kits I enjoy a quick build of a well fitting kit (the Tamiya Cromwell/Centaur as Paul mentioned is probably one of the best kits to build straight from the box for it’s fit and details) as well as getting my teeth into a lesser kit to fix the problems and get it go together (a bit of a challenge makes for a satisfying model) and this is where a build review can be helpful.
